Early Sunday morning, around 2am, a single-vehicle collision occurred near Leigh Delamere services in Wiltshire. The car veered off the eastbound carriageway, resulting in the death of a 32-year-old man and serious injuries to another passenger. Wiltshire Police, along with Dorset and Wiltshire Fire and Rescue Service and South West Ambulance Service, rushed to the scene, prompting National Highways to close all eastbound lanes between junction 18 (Bath) and junction 17 (Chippenham). National Highways has been tight-lipped about a precise reopening time, stating only that the closure will likely remain in place throughout the morning and afternoon. A spokesperson noted, 'Early indications suggest this won’t be a quick resolution,' leaving commuters scrambling for alternatives. Diversion routes have been set up, guiding drivers through a labyrinth of A-roads—A46, A420, and A350—to rejoin the M4 at junction 17. Adding to the turmoil, a second accident occurred further west, near junction 19 (Bristol), causing additional lane closures and delays. This double whammy has turned the M4 into a motorist’s nightmare, with congestion stretching for miles. As of the latest update, all lanes between Bristol and Bath have reopened, but the section between Bath and Chippenham remains closed.
